These already exist, but needed checking in
Signed-off-by: Martyn Ranyard <m@rtyn.berlin>
This commit is contained in:
parent
d31f9e8b51
commit
9fe080045b
|
@ -0,0 +1,30 @@
|
|||
apiVersion: argoproj.io/v1alpha1
|
||||
kind: Application
|
||||
metadata:
|
||||
name: mysql4blog
|
||||
namespace: argocd
|
||||
spec:
|
||||
destination:
|
||||
namespace: blog
|
||||
server: https://kubernetes.default.svc
|
||||
project: apps
|
||||
source:
|
||||
chart: mariadb
|
||||
helm:
|
||||
parameters:
|
||||
- name: auth.database
|
||||
value: writefreely
|
||||
- name: auth.forcePassword
|
||||
value: "true"
|
||||
- name: auth.username
|
||||
value: writefreely
|
||||
- name: auth.existingSecret
|
||||
value: db-creds
|
||||
- name: primary.service.type
|
||||
value: ClusterIP
|
||||
repoURL: https://charts.bitnami.com/bitnami
|
||||
targetRevision: 14.1.4
|
||||
syncPolicy:
|
||||
automated:
|
||||
prune: true
|
||||
selfHeal: true
|
|
@ -0,0 +1,30 @@
|
|||
apiVersion: argoproj.io/v1alpha1
|
||||
kind: Application
|
||||
metadata:
|
||||
name: mysql4nextcloud
|
||||
namespace: argocd
|
||||
spec:
|
||||
destination:
|
||||
namespace: nextcloud
|
||||
server: https://kubernetes.default.svc
|
||||
project: apps
|
||||
source:
|
||||
chart: mariadb
|
||||
helm:
|
||||
parameters:
|
||||
- name: auth.database
|
||||
value: nextcloud
|
||||
- name: auth.forcePassword
|
||||
value: "true"
|
||||
- name: auth.username
|
||||
value: nextcloud
|
||||
- name: auth.existingSecret
|
||||
value: db-creds
|
||||
- name: primary.service.type
|
||||
value: ClusterIP
|
||||
repoURL: https://charts.bitnami.com/bitnami
|
||||
targetRevision: 14.1.4
|
||||
syncPolicy:
|
||||
automated:
|
||||
prune: true
|
||||
selfHeal: true
|
|
@ -0,0 +1,61 @@
|
|||
apiVersion: argoproj.io/v1alpha1
|
||||
kind: Application
|
||||
metadata:
|
||||
name: paperless-ngx
|
||||
namespace: argocd
|
||||
spec:
|
||||
destination:
|
||||
namespace: paperless-ngx
|
||||
server: https://kubernetes.default.svc
|
||||
project: apps
|
||||
source:
|
||||
chart: paperless-ngx
|
||||
helm:
|
||||
parameters:
|
||||
- name: service.main.type
|
||||
value: "LoadBalancer"
|
||||
- name: persistence.data.enabled
|
||||
value: "true"
|
||||
- name: persistence.data.size
|
||||
value: "1Gi"
|
||||
- name: persistence.data.accessMode
|
||||
value: ReadWriteOnce
|
||||
- name: persistence.data.storageClass
|
||||
value: "rook-ceph-block-ssd"
|
||||
- name: persistence.media.enabled
|
||||
value: "true"
|
||||
- name: persistence.media.size
|
||||
value: "8Gi"
|
||||
- name: persistence.media.accessMode
|
||||
value: ReadWriteOnce
|
||||
- name: persistence.media.storageClass
|
||||
value: "rook-ceph-block-ssd"
|
||||
- name: persistence.export.enabled
|
||||
value: "true"
|
||||
- name: persistence.export.size
|
||||
value: "1Gi"
|
||||
- name: persistence.export.accessMode
|
||||
value: ReadWriteOnce
|
||||
- name: persistence.export.storageClass
|
||||
value: "rook-ceph-block-ssd"
|
||||
- name: persistence.consume.enabled
|
||||
value: "true"
|
||||
- name: persistence.consume.size
|
||||
value: "4Gi"
|
||||
- name: persistence.consume.accessMode
|
||||
value: ReadWriteOnce
|
||||
- name: persistence.consume.storageClass
|
||||
value: "rook-ceph-block-ssd"
|
||||
- name: postgresql.enabled
|
||||
value: "true"
|
||||
- name: postgresql.primary.persistence.enabled
|
||||
value: "true"
|
||||
- name: postgresql.primary.persistence.storageClass
|
||||
value: "rook-ceph-block-ssd"
|
||||
- name: env.TZ
|
||||
value: "Europe/Berlin"
|
||||
repoURL: https://charts.gabe565.com
|
||||
targetRevision: 0.7.8
|
||||
syncPolicy:
|
||||
automated:
|
||||
selfHeal: true
|
Loading…
Reference in New Issue